Changeset 1146 in ProjectBuilder
- Timestamp:
- Jan 10, 2011, 2:51:59 AM (14 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
devel/pb/bin/pb
r1145 r1146 2233 2233 2234 2234 # Set which port the VM will use to communicate 2235 $pm->run_on_start( pb_set_port());2235 $pm->run_on_start(\&pb_set_port); 2236 2236 2237 2237 my $counter = 0; … … 2518 2518 2519 2519 # Set which port the VM will use to communicate 2520 $pm->run_on_start( pb_set_port());2520 $pm->run_on_start(\&pb_set_port); 2521 2521 2522 2522 my $counter = 0; … … 3465 3465 3466 3466 die "No port passed in parameter. Report to dev team\n" if (not defined $port); 3467 pb_log(2,"pb_get_port with $port\n"); 3467 3468 my $nport = $port; 3468 3469 # Maybe a port was given as parameter so overwrite … … 3472 3473 $nport += $ENV{'PBVMPORT'} if ((defined $pbparallel) && (defined $ENV{'PBVMPORT'})); 3473 3474 } 3475 pb_log(2,"pb_get_port returns $nport\n"); 3474 3476 return($nport); 3475 3477 } … … 3478 3480 3479 3481 my ($pid,$ident) = @_; 3482 pb_log(2,"pb_set_port for VM ($pid), id $ident\n"); 3480 3483 $ENV{'PBVMPORT'} = $ident; 3484 pb_log(2,"pb_set_port sets PBVMPORT in env to $ENV{'PBVMPORT'}\n"); 3481 3485 } 3482 3486 … … 3485 3489 my $vtype = shift; 3486 3490 3487 my ($pbvmmem) = pb_conf_get_if("pbvmmem"); 3488 3491 pb_log(2,"pb_set_parallel vtype: $vtype\n"); 3489 3492 # Take care of memory size if VM, parallel mode and more than 1 action 3490 3493 if ((defined $pbparallel) && ($pbparallel ne 1) && ($vtype eq "vm")) { … … 3506 3509 my $ram = $si->{"totalram"}-$si->{"sharedram"}-$si->{"bufferram"}; 3507 3510 my $ram2; 3511 my ($pbvmmem) = pb_conf_get_if("pbvmmem"); 3512 3508 3513 if ((defined $pbvmmem) and (defined $pbvmmem->{$ENV{'PBPROJ'}})) { 3509 3514 $ram2 = $pbvmmem->{$ENV{'PBPROJ'}}; … … 3516 3521 } 3517 3522 } 3523 pb_log(2,"pb_set_parallel returns: $pbparallel\n"); 3518 3524 return($pbparallel); 3519 3525 }
Note:
See TracChangeset
for help on using the changeset viewer.